20080210141 | Skid Base for Portable Building - A molded plastic skid base for a resin building is formed with all of its openings facing downward and with runners integral with a deck that forms a floor of the base. Replaceable wear plates cover the bottoms of the runners and have truck loading notches molded at their ends and a longitudinal channel in which fastener heads are positioned. Stake down slots are provided in the ends of the runners and wear plates in a diagonal orientation so as to be aligned toward the center of the building, below the base. The floor of the base is a grid formed of diagonally oriented ribs, at least some of which may be shorter in their center than at their ends, is crowned in the center and has openings which taper upwardly. A solid sheet may be placed over the grid to close it. Bosses for receiving the wear plate mounting fasteners are positioned at the same locations along the sides of the base as the fastener mounting locations for attaching the building side walls to the base, to provide a greater thickness of material at those locations for the building sidewall fasteners to penetrate. Edges of a septic tank opening formed in the base are slanted downwardly and rear corners of the opening are triangular in shape. Downwardly opening openings are also formed in the base into which weights and weight covers may be fixed. | 09-04-2008 |

20100083881 | PALLET ASSEMBLY - A pallet assembly includes an upper deck and a lower deck spaced by a plurality of columns. The weight of the pallet is reduced without significant reduction in strength by providing only a single cross beam in each of the upper and lower reinforcement members and orienting them perpendicular to one another. The reinforcement members are minimized for weight reduction and for improved performance in heat tests. The peripheral rail of the upper reinforcement member is reduced such that it rests on only an inwardly open recess on an inner corner of each of the corner columns. This reduces the size and weight of the upper reinforcement member, while still providing support to the upper deck. Additionally, the peripheral rails of both the upper and lower decks are reduced in length such that either ledge does not directly support them while the pallet is stored on a rack. As a result, in the case of sufficient heat source on the pallets, the pallets will eventually collapse without interference from the reinforcement members and at least partially smother the heat source. | 04-08-2010 |

20130068143 | SHIPPING PALLET POST REINFORCEMENT - A pallet used for stowing and transporting items for shipping. The pallet design of the present invention includes a top deck, a bottom skid, and several posts for providing support between the top deck and bottom skid. The posts are integrated with either the top deck or bottom skid. Within each pallet post is a steel tube reinforcement that is overmolded directly into the bottom skid, or is assembled after the pallet post is molded. The supports, which are typically hollow posts, are molded onto either the top deck or bottom skid, and a thermoplastic weld or adhesive joint is applied to the posts to complete the assembly. The palled having the integrated posts and reinforcements provides an economical approach of reinforcing pallet posts to absorb tow fork impact. | 03-21-2013 |
